Transaction 779853d154eea951294537031725a422e8a05b205182070680d0e3d61e22e103

3 Input
2 Outputs
  • 779853d154eea951294537031725a422e8a05b205182070680d0e3d61e22e103:0
  • value  998256
    address  3QQ9f2J6NSMW1AoALnUp3s7QYKj3tgMQTe
  • 779853d154eea951294537031725a422e8a05b205182070680d0e3d61e22e103:1
  • value  253670
    address  179PKVvGxL45R6sLpRNhgmLSeywvAFurg4